MEMORIAL SERVICE - 11:00 AM - METHODIST CHURCH
The Granville Museum conducts a Memorial Service each year remembering ones from Granville who have passed away since the past year's Heritage Day. Anyone who was born in Granville or lived there sometime during their life will be recognized. The families of these loved ones are asked to be a part of this memorial service. A candle will be lit in the memory of each person who has passed away this year, as well as anyone else that a family member would like to remember.
